0

私は Java アプリケーションに取り組んでおり、アプリケーションを Elasticsearch サーバーに接続する必要があります。

私は Java と Elasticsearch の両方に慣れていないため、どのように進めればよいかわかりません。意味のあるドキュメントは見つかりませんでした。

誰でも私を案内してもらえますか。前もって感謝します。

4

1 に答える 1

1

Elasticsearch 自体は Java で記述されており、Java Native Clientがあります。

また、任意の言語とやり取りできる REST API も備えています (これはより一般的に使用されており、Java と Python から接続する方法です)。REST 呼び出しを行うには、 Apache HTTP コンポーネントなどを使用する必要があります。

REST 呼び出しの上にさらに Java OO レイヤーを追加するJestという別のプロジェクトがあります。

于 2016-09-08T04:59:22.370 に答える